The UK market size value per capita for women and girls' skirts made of synthetic fibers is projected to gradually increase from $3.05 in 2024 to $3.12 by 2028. The year-on-year increase remains consistent at approximately 0.65%. This steady growth suggests a stable demand for synthetic fiber skirts.
